  • Job Description:
  • + Actively participates in performance improvement activities, value analysis projects, and supply chain cost reduction initiatives.
+ Initiates supply return requests and ensures items are ready for pickup and return. + Manages product recall activities, ensuring affected products are pulled from use and packaged for return. + Ensures staff is aware of new items, product changes, substitutions, back orders, and changes to storage locations. + Meets with suppliers to resolve issues, source products and equipment, and arrange necessary training. + Coordinates product trials and evaluations in conjunction with stakeholders. + Manages supplies and materials in assigned specialty department or procedure area. + Establishes and maintains Periodic Automatic Replenishment (PAR) levels for stocked items, ensuring proper rotation and labeling, and removing expired goods. + Builds and maintains relationships with clinical and non-clinical customers to understand needs and product changes. + Coordinates or participates in assigned committee activities. + Performs other duties as assigned.
